1 O saving Victim, op'ning wide
The gate of heav'n to all below!
Our foes press on from ev'ry side;
Your aid supply, your strength bestow.
2 To your great name be endless praise,
Immortal Godhead, One in Three;
O grant us endless length of days
When our true native land we see.
LATIN -
1 O salutaris hostia,
Quae caeli pandis ostium:
Bella premunt hostilia,
Da robur fer auxilium.
2 Uni trinoque Domino
Sit sempiterna gloria:
Qui vitam sine termino
Nobis donet in patria.
